平衡重、三支点、前移式,锂电叉车常见类型怎么区分?

物流行业中,电动叉车凭借低噪音、零排放等优势成为仓储与搬运作业的主流设备。在众多电动叉车类型中,平衡重式、三支点及前移式锂电叉车因结构设计差异,在适用场景和作业效率上表现出明显区别。了解这些类型的核心特征,有助于根据实际需求选择合适的设备,避免因选型不当影响作业效果。

平衡重式锂电叉车是市场上应用最广泛的类型之一,其核心结构特点是车体前部配备货叉,后部设置独立的平衡重块。这种设计通过前后轮轴的配重平衡原理,确保货物装卸过程中车体稳定性。平衡重式叉车的转向系统通常采用后轮转向方式,车身整体长度较长,转弯半径相对较大。在实际作业中,它凭借较强的重载能力和抗干扰性能,适用于室外搬运、长距离运输及大型货物堆垛场景,例如港口集装箱装卸、大型仓储中心的货物中转等。随着锂电技术的发展,平衡重式锂电叉车已成为替代传统燃油平衡重叉车的环保选择,电池续航能力和充电效率成为用户关注的重要指标,其续航里程一般可满足8-12小时的连续作业需求。

三支点电动叉车以紧凑的结构设计著称,其支撑结构采用三个接触地面的支点布局,常见形式为前轮双轮转向、后轮单轮驱动,或前轮单轮转向、后轮双轮驱动。这种设计显著缩小了车体宽度,转弯半径仅为平衡重式叉车的三分之二,使其在狭窄通道中表现出色。三支点叉车的转向系统反应灵敏,适合超市仓库、车间内部等空间有限的场景,能够灵活应对货架间的狭窄通道作业。由于车身紧凑,其整体重量相对较轻,能耗控制较好,适合短距离高频次的货物搬运,例如电商仓库的分拣区周转、小型工厂的原材料转运等。转向轮直径一般比平衡重式小10%-15%,以适应更窄的通道,电池容量通常设计为48V/50Ah,支持4-6小时连续作业,能满足中小型仓库的日常周转需求。

前移式锂电叉车则专注于高位货架作业场景,其独特的门架前移机构是核心特征。这类叉车的货叉可通过液压系统沿导轨前后移动,无需转向即可在货架区域内完成堆垛操作,双前轮支撑设计确保了车体在高位作业时的稳定性。前移式叉车的堆垛高度通常可达5米以上,能高效存取高层货架中的货物,广泛应用于电商立体仓库、医药冷链仓储等对空间利用率要求高的场所。与前两种类型相比,前移式叉车的作业半径较小,转向系统主要控制车体整体移动,更适合固定区域内的精准堆垛作业。门架前移速度可达0.5-1.2米/秒,提升作业效率,电池系统多采用磷酸铁锂电池,循环寿命可达2000次以上,满足每日100次以上的堆垛作业需求。

在实际选型时,可通过三点关键特征区分三种类型:支撑结构上,平衡重式依赖配重块平衡,三支点依靠三角形支撑,前移式通过门架前移优化空间;转向特性方面,平衡重式转向半径大,三支点转向灵活,前移式转向以车体整体移动为主;适用场景上,平衡重式适合重载长距离,三支点适合狭窄通道短距离,前移式适合高层货架作业。此外,锂电化趋势下,这三种类型均已推出电动版本,用户在关注续航、充电效率等参数的同时,需结合作业场景的具体需求综合考量,选择最适配的叉车类型。
